It's about consciousness, people: improv, poetry, and the moment before fear, that clear aesthetic. Perhaps serving as a proxy for clarity, or as a visceral temporary life inside the mind of an artist, this is an experiment in sound and language, and thus emotion.

With an advanced technical sense of polyrhythm and a soul-drenched vocal style, Saba Abraha again shows us how to follow our own light, creating a mix of styles between RnB and Soul. It's a thoughtful shuffle-stick-jam with synth poured over the top like so much Cognac.

Saba Abraha is a soul singer-songwriter originally from Ethiopia. This song is featured on our Lost Treasure - Soul playlist.
